Cleaning and replacing the spark plugs (fig. 73)
Spark plugs are essential to smooth engine running and
should be checked at regular intervals. This provides a
good measure of engine condition.
Contact an Ducati Dealer or Authorised Workshop to have
the spark plug checked and changed, if needed. Their staff
shall check the color of the ceramic insulator on the central
electrode: a light brown, even colour is a sign of good
engine condition.
Check wear on the central electrode and the gap: it should
be 0.6-0.7 mm.
Important
If gap is too wide or too close, engine performance
will be affected. This could also cause misfiring or irregular
idling.
